July 30, 2009

The Mediation Center of Charlottesville supports President Obama's "Beer Summit."

The Center wrote a letter to Obama agreeing with his decision to invite Professor Henry Gates and Sgt. James Crowley to the White House to meet and speak with each other.

The Mediation Center is a place where people in conflict can come together with experienced mediators who help resolve disputes.

The Center believes the "Beer Summit" will be a beneficial process for all parties involved.

"If both parties come and meet with President Obama, sit down and listen to each other, I think that could be an ultimately incredible process," said Patrice Kyger, the active Executive Director of the Mediation Center.

Center officials say mediation allows two arguing parties to transform conflict into an opportunity for growth.
